Many of us say that we want our students to approach learning with “wonder,” but how does the classical tradition equip us to do this? At Repairing the Ruins 2025, we will look to the medieval tradition for inspiration as we contemplate ways to re-enchant the classroom while working “for Christ and His Kingdom.”
We invite you to join classical Christian educators from around the country—and the world—for an unforgettable three days in Dallas, TX.

Can I attend Leader's Day AND a Practicum?
For the best experience, we would recommend that an attendee choose between Leader’s Day, Academic Leader’s Day, or a Practicum, since all are full-day programs on Wednesday happening simultaneously.
– Leader’s Day is geared toward heads of school, board chairs, and other school leaders.
– Academic Leader’s Day is geared toward academic deans, department heads, lead teachers, or specialty teachers.
– The Teaching Latin and Coaching Struggling Students Practicums are geared toward teachers with the relevant focuses or needs.
– The Startup Schools Practicum would be valuable for new or potential school founders.
